    Thanks, Photobygms. I havent seen that movie (I dont have Netfilx), but Donau City Tower 1, or (DC1) as it is called here, is interesting. It has a pendulum, or tuned mass damper inside to keep it stable in case of earthquakes -- which do happen here.

    It's an ancient part of the woodland and all the trees in that part are dead, the wood is gnarled and theres no leaves, I think the birds love that area because of all the bugs living in the fossiled bark.

    The ChiffChaffs come over from Scandinavia to summer here although we do now have some residents. The Chaffinches are one of our most abundant birds.

    It's one of the reasons I haven't bought a Canon EOS R7 because they don't work with the Tamron 150-600mm G1. For now I'll stick with my 7D mkII, the latest software gives me perfectly usable 16,000 ISO images from my 7D mkII so I'm happy with my 'old faithful'.
